在idea中用git提交代码,出现Push rejected: Push to origin/dev was rejected
·
上传到dev这个分支报错(我感觉这个dev创建的不是很标准,刚开始玩。。),一直报这个错误,后来换master也是报类似的错误,网上搜了一下,说是提交的代码和历史数据不符合;这个可能是操作问题,由于是刚接触,操作不是很规范,也不是很明白,有几次上传成功,然后又删除了,不知道是不是这样的操作引起了它的不适。
解决办法是,选中要上传代码的文件夹,然后右键选中git Bash Here这个选项,输入下面代码,
git pull origin master –allow-unrelated-histories
git push -u origin master -f
注意:不知道什么原因这个不适用到dev这个分支。
更多推荐
已为社区贡献1条内容
所有评论(0)